    I did a quote today for an occupational therapist . She has a woman who is on Work Cover and they are paying for her lawn and garden maintenance. Yes that is right they are paying for it.

    Well anyway they contacted a big reputable company to do the job and they did it and she got hold of me off my web page to come and fix it up.

    The place was butchered. Edges looked like they had been done with an axe and they had dumped the clippings in an old unregistered trailer on the property.

    The place was in a mess to start with but they left it in a mess. Did'nt even blower vac the paved areas. The company paid big money too.

    So now I have to fix it but it is interesting to find out that Work Cover pays for this type of thing
